What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to place most kinds of debris into a dumpster rental in Brookfield.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ental hazard,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ental company if you're uncertain.

That makes most kinds of debris that you can put in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any sort of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Certain types of okay deb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should ask the rental company whether you have to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.

What You Need To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Brookfield

The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Brookfield will depend on several factors.

The size of the dumpster is a major consideration that will impact your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are more often than not more economical than bigger ones.

The amount of time that you have to keep the dumpster rental in Brookfield will also impact the cost. The more time you keep the dumpster, the further you can anticipate to pay.

Services are another consideration that could impact your overall cost. Many companies include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their prices. Some companies, however, fee for all these services. That makes it important for you to ask about any hidden fees.

Finally, you may need to pay higher prices for disposing of specific substances. If you want to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for example, you can expect to pay a little more.


40 yard dumpster measurements

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't absolutely con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the largest size that most dumpster businesses typically rent, so it's perfect for large resid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ris which could fit in this container comprise: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able dwelling
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major improvement to a substantial dwelling
  • Substantial am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

City regulations on dumpster rental in Brookfield

Most cities or municipalities do not have many regulations regarding dumpster rental in Brookfield as long as you keep the dumpster totally on your own property during the rental period. In case you have to place your container on the street in any way, you will likely have to obtain a permit from the appropriate building permit office in your town.

Most dumpster rental firms in Brookfield will take care of procuring this permit for you if you rent from them. Ensure that in case you're planning to set the dumpster on the street, the company has made the proper arrangements. You must also guarantee that you get the permit in a timely manner and at the right cost. In case you believed the dumpster business was getting a permit and they didn't, you will be the one who will need to pay the fine that's issued by the authorities.


Long-Term vs Roll off dumpsters

Whether or not you desire a permanent or roll-off dumpster depends on the type of job and service you'll need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for continuous needs that continue longer than just a day or two.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is simply what the name implies; a one time need for job-specific waste removal.

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are usually larger containers that may handle all the waste that comes with that specific job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are generally smaller containers as they are em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.

Should you request a long-lasting dumpster, some businesses need at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Roll off dumpsters merely need a rental fee for the time that you just keep the dumpster on the job.

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.

1. Engage the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.

2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items should not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and be sure you lock it when you're done.

4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while carrying heavy things to the dumpster.

6. Just let adults near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Be sure you have plenty of lighting when transferring deb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.
